Output 12b106d16751c54b34ad4b4fa52ea757bf81fcf0ae6b9d67db9a2fc9df9ed91f:0

value
694767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c53e8ca63e4b8b18df621fa3fc54c3433c142cb4 OP_EQUAL
address
3KfwyLtKsPw5Jv8FoGGkRfYiSwnmy6LBrs
transaction
12b106d16751c54b34ad4b4fa52ea757bf81fcf0ae6b9d67db9a2fc9df9ed91f
spent
true